Am Montag, 2. September 2019 08:12:20 UTC+2 schrieb Andrew Milner: > > in the code you edited - have you tried changing maximumfractiondigits and > minimumfractiondigits from 1 to 0? It seems to me - without having the > skin - that this should do what you want!!!! If it does not do the trick > then put it back to 1 and wait for Pat!! > > > > On Monday, 2 September 2019 09:04:07 UTC+3, Stefan wrote: >> >> Hello. >> I wanted to ask if the wind values (in the live view) could be displayed >> as a whole, without them? I mean that. Currently, the values are always >> displayed with 3.2 km/h, but more interesting would be 3 km/h. Is that >> possible? >> >> Am Samstag, 1.
